Cheeke Mews Cheeke Street is a residential building situated on Cheeke Street, Exeter, EX1 with 4 addresses.
It ranks as the 643rd largest and 73rd most expensive of the 811 buildings in the EX1 area. The dominant property type is a mid-century flat built between 1936 and 1979.
The building contains a total of 4 properties: 4 flats.
Sale prices range from £125,870 for 1 bedroom leasehold flats (409 ft2) to £164,155 for 2 bedroom leasehold flats (527 ft2) .
Monthly rental prices range from £770 pcm for 1 bed flats to £942 pcm for 2 bed flats.
The gross rental yield is between 6.9% and 7.3%.
The average value per square foot is £304.
The last sale in Cheeke Mews Cheeke Street sold for £30,000 on 13th December 1996. Since then prices are down an average of 0.0%.
The current average value in the building is £135,441.
The Cheeke Mews Cheeke Street Sales Market has increased by 19.9% over the last 10 years.
